VeriSign and KickApps Collaborate to Power
VeriSign® Social Media Solution
Social Media Platform Combined with VeriSign Digital Infrastructure
Enables Web Publishers to Offer Richer Multiplatform Experience
CTIA Wireless IT & Entertainment, San Francisco, CA - October
23, 2007 – VeriSign (NASDAQ: VRSN), the leading provider
of digital infrastructure for the networked world, and KickApps, the
leading hosted social media platform, today announced a strategic alliance
aimed at giving Web publishers easy access to a community building platform
and unique mobile media uploading. As part of the alliance, VeriSign
has integrated the KickApps hosted social media platform within the
VeriSign® Social Media Solution.
New functionality showcased by the two companies at
CTIA Wireless IT & Entertainment 2007 enables web publishers to
extend social media experiences beyond a broadband computer and onto
mobile handsets. Because the solution also incorporates VeriSign’s Intelligent
CDN and Mobile
Content Delivery Network, Web publishers and media and entertainment
companies looking to deploy social media features on existing sites
can extend the online community experience across multiple screens.

The companies demonstrated the mobile uploading of
video and photos to KickApps hosted social media site. Using the mobile
phone, community members simply select and upload the video or photo
they wish to share on the community site. VeriSign and KickApps created www.motorheadrally.tv
to demonstrate this capability to attendees of the event.

The KickApps hosted social media platform allows publishers
to easily create and deploy social and rich media powered online communities
on their existing websites. Anchored around social networking, user-generated
content, programmable video players, Widgets for content syndication,
and a content and community management backbone, the white label platform
is highly customizable to match the look and feel of the publisher’s
website, providing a feature-rich, branded social media experience as
users navigate between a publisher’s website and its KickApps hosted
community.
